What is the difference between Manager Application Development vs Software Development Manager?
| Aspect | Manager Application Development | Software Development Manager |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Focus | Overseeing application projects, managing development teams for specific applications | Managing overall software development teams, including multiple projects and platforms |
| Required Skills | Application lifecycle, project management, team leadership, technical knowledge of specific platforms | Software architecture, team coordination, technical expertise across software products |
| Work Environment | Typically in organizations developing specific applications or software solutions | Broader software development departments across various projects |
The Manager Application Development role focuses on leading teams that develop specific applications, emphasizing project management and application lifecycle. In contrast, a Software Development Manager oversees multiple software projects and teams, with a broader scope. Both roles require strong leadership and technical skills, but their scope and focus differ based on the organization's needs.

Job description
You'll lead a talented team of software developers and application support engineers while partnering with business leaders to deliver technology that makes a meaningful impact across our organization.
What You'll Do
Lead & Inspire
- Build, mentor, and develop a high-performing team of software developers and application support engineers.
- Establish team priorities, remove obstacles, and create an environment where engineers can do their best work.
- Coach team members through career development, performance management, and technical growth.
- Foster a culture of accountability, collaboration, continuous learning, and engineering excellence.
- Partner with business and operational leaders to understand needs and translate them into a clear technology roadmap.
- Prioritize competing initiatives across new development, system integrations, enhancements, and production support.
- Lead delivery of software solutions through every phase of the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C).
- Promote best practices for design, testing, code reviews, CI/CD, release management, and documentation.
- Own the health and reliability of business-critical applications.
- Lead incident response, root cause analysis, and continuous improvement efforts.
- Establish support processes including triage, escalation, change management, and on-call procedures.
- Drive measurable improvements in application stability and service performance.
- Oversee development using the Microsoft technology stack, including .NET, C#, Azure, and Azure Service Bus.
- Collaborate with Enterprise Architecture to deliver scalable, secure, and resilient solutions.
- Ensure engineering standards and architectural governance are consistently followed.
- Oversee reporting and analytics solutions using Power BI and Databricks/Azure.
- Ensure reporting platforms and data pipelines are accurate, reliable, and well governed.
- Evaluate emerging technologies including AI, automation, and new Azure capabilities.
- Lead proof-of-concepts and pilot programs that solve real business challenges.
- Introduce new technologies with appropriate security, compliance, and operational governance.
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Information Systems,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- 10+ years of experience delivering and supporting enterprise business applications.
- 4+ years leading software development and application support teams.
- Strong experience with Microsoft technologies including:
- .NET
- C#
- Microsoft Azure
- Azure Service Bus
- Experience leading applications through the complete Software Development Life Cycle.
- Experience with Power BI and modern data platforms such as Databricks.
- Strong understanding of DevOps, CI/CD, testing, release management, and change management.
- Experience improving production reliability through monitoring, observability, incident management, and root cause analysis.
- Knowledge of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) concepts including SLIs, SLOs, telemetry, logging, tracing, and alerting.
- Ability to collaborate with architects, technical teams, and business leaders to deliver scalable solutions.
- Excellent communication, leadership, and stakeholder management skills.
